Flying from Amman to Dusseldorf: what you need to know
Amman's main base, Queen Alia International Airport (AMM), is where countless incredible trips begin. Explore the departure options from here when planning your flight from Amman to Dusseldorf.
When working out where to land in Dusseldorf, Dusseldorf International Airport (DUS) and Weeze Airport (NRN) are the chief entry points.
Around 5 hours 15 minutes is how long you'll be in transit on a direct Amman to Dusseldorf flight.
Dusseldorf is one hour behind Amman and follows the UTC+1 timezone.

Arriving in Dusseldorf
Dusseldorf International Airport (DUS)
Dusseldorf International Airport (DUS) to central Dusseldorf takes around 15 minutes by car. The centre is roughly 8 kilometres away.
It typically takes 20 minutes to get there on public transport.

Weeze Airport (NRN)
Weeze Airport (NRN) is around 64 kilometres from central Dusseldorf. Once you've disembarked your flight from Amman to Dusseldorf, it'll take you approximately 1 hour 5 minutes to get to the heart of the city in a ride-share or cab.
The journey will take roughly 2 hours 20 minutes on public transport.

Best time to go to Dusseldorf
January is the quietest month for flights from Amman to Dusseldorf, while June is the busiest. Pick the ideal time to visit Dusseldorf based on whether you like a bustling atmosphere or a more laid-back vibe.
Before locking in your Amman to Dusseldorf tickets, consider the type of weather you enjoy. August is the warmest month in Dusseldorf, with temperatures ranging from 12ºC (54ºF) to 28ºC (82ºF).
Search for cheap flights from Amman to Dusseldorf in January if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between -3ºC (27ºF) and 7ºC (45ºF) on average.
